The life of a river rat. The people who live in the fishing camps are a different breed of cat. I've fished this spot many times back in my fishing days. Caught a lot of crappie and bream here. You don't fish it at flood stage.
From top of the levee; inside the levee is the flood and out the leeve all is normal. I live in Marion and part of my property tax is a levee fee to maintaihe levee. Without the levee, our property is in the flood zone of the Mississippi River. At the same time I've almost been flooded out by the water not being able to get to the river. Strange,but true.
This gate is locked to most. A select few have keys to all the crossings. Many years ago my late Father had all those keys. My father was a well known hunter in the area and someone of prominence hooked him up. you can see the flood water on one side and dry land on the other.

Reworked R90 head. I did the head 15 years ago. I may have posted it allready. Looking for some parts I need, I ran across it. BMW airhead is a real work of art. I really admire the simple the simple mechanical designand at the same time it's like a work of art unto itself. But really it's just a another very important part of the comple engine and and of the whole complete motorcycle.
I'm probably the 3rd or 4th owner. I really don't know.
Smewhere along the line some spark plugs were installed without the proper antisieve compounnd applied to the threads. I fixxed it with some correct size timeserts. Nice fix and a head ready for installation.
